Hughes Aircraft Co. Ground System Group.


Parties: The Ground System Group of Hughes Aircraft Hughes Aircraft Company was a major aerospace and defense company founded by Howard Hughes. The group was based near Ballona Creek, in Culver City, California, USA, on the Pacific Coast.

Hughes Aircraft was acquired by General Motors in 1985.
 Co., Fullerton and the United States Air Force United States Air Force (USAF)

Major component of the U.S. military organization, with primary responsibility for air warfare, air defense, and military space research. It also provides air services in coordination with the other military branches. U.S.
 Electronic Systems Division Value: $77 million Nature of contract: Hughes' Ground System Group was awarded a contract from the USAF to build a new NATO NATO: see North Atlantic Treaty Organization.
NATO
 in full North Atlantic Treaty Organization

International military alliance created to defend western Europe against a possible Soviet invasion.
 air defense system for Iceland. The system is to provide command, control and communication systems to improve overall air defense capabilities for Iceland and the surrounding North Atlantic region monitored and protected by NATO forces See: force(s). . Duration: 66 months Note: Hughes is a subsidiary of GM Hughes Electronics
